Trump Administration Appeals Ruling Against $100,000 H-1B Visa Fee | Spotlight | N18G

U.S. President Donald Trump's administration has challenged a federal judge’s decision to strike down the controversial $100,000 H-1B visa fee, setting the stage for a major legal battle over one of America’s most debated immigration policies. The judge ruled that the fee amounted to an unlawful tax that could not be imposed without Congressional approval. The administration, however, has appealed the decision and is seeking to restore the policy. The case is especially significant because Indian nationals make up the largest share of H-1B visa holders, and many US technology companies, universities and healthcare institutions depend on the program to recruit skilled foreign workers.
